Digital electronic control unit
First Claim
Patent Images
1. A digital electronic control unit for an appliance, comprising:
- a plurality of sensor drive circuits, each driving one of a plurality of sensing elements external to said digital electronic control unit, each sensing element converting a sensed parameter to an electrical signal;
an analog multiplexer that receives the electrical signal from each external sensing element and selectively routes a selected electrical signal to a multiplexer output;
an analog-to-digital converter connected to the output of said analog multiplexer and converting the selected electrical signal to digital values;
a linearity, sensitivity and offset correction circuit connected to the output of said analog-to-digital converter for correcting the digital values received from it, using sensor calibration data stored in a non-volatile memory;
a central control unit that receives corrected output from said linearity, sensitivity and offset correction circuit, and generates control signals for operating the appliance, as well as selection signals for controlling said analog multiplexer, using control data supplied by the non-volatile memory;
a digital de-multiplexer connected to an output of said central control unit for selecting one of a plurality of de-multiplexer outputs to which a de-multiplexer input coupled to said central control unit is to be connected;
a plurality of control latches, each connected at one of said de-multiplexer outputs, for storing the digital data received from it and actuating a part of the appliance to adjust the sensed parameter;
a non-volatile memory that stores data and control parameters for the operation of said central control unit, linearity, sensitivity and offset correction circuit.
1 Assignment
0 Petitions
Accused Products
Abstract
A digital electronic control unit that provides an efficient, miniature, reliable and cost-effective control mechanism for use in household and commercial appliances. It further is capable of real-time-based control, remote control and networking.
-
Citations
44 Claims
-
1. A digital electronic control unit for an appliance, comprising:
-
a plurality of sensor drive circuits, each driving one of a plurality of sensing elements external to said digital electronic control unit, each sensing element converting a sensed parameter to an electrical signal;
an analog multiplexer that receives the electrical signal from each external sensing element and selectively routes a selected electrical signal to a multiplexer output;
an analog-to-digital converter connected to the output of said analog multiplexer and converting the selected electrical signal to digital values;
a linearity, sensitivity and offset correction circuit connected to the output of said analog-to-digital converter for correcting the digital values received from it, using sensor calibration data stored in a non-volatile memory;
a central control unit that receives corrected output from said linearity, sensitivity and offset correction circuit, and generates control signals for operating the appliance, as well as selection signals for controlling said analog multiplexer, using control data supplied by the non-volatile memory;
a digital de-multiplexer connected to an output of said central control unit for selecting one of a plurality of de-multiplexer outputs to which a de-multiplexer input coupled to said central control unit is to be connected;
a plurality of control latches, each connected at one of said de-multiplexer outputs, for storing the digital data received from it and actuating a part of the appliance to adjust the sensed parameter;
a non-volatile memory that stores data and control parameters for the operation of said central control unit, linearity, sensitivity and offset correction circuit.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20)
-
-
21. A digital electronic control unit for an appliance, comprising:
-
a plurality of sensor drive circuits, each driving one of a plurality of sensing elements external to said digital electronic control unit, each sensing element converting a sensed parameter to an electrical signal;
an analog multiplexer that receives the electrical signal from each external sensing element and selectively routes a selected electrical signal to a multiplexer output;
an analog-to-digital converter connected to said multiplexer output and converting the selected electrical signal to digital values;
a linearity, sensitivity and offset correction circuit connected to the output of said analog-to-digital converter for correcting the digital values received from it, using sensor calibration data stored in a non-volatile memory;
a central control unit receiving the corrected output from said linearity, sensitivity and offset correction circuit, and generating control signals for operating the appliance, as well as selection signals for controlling said analog multiplexer, using control data supplied by the non-volatile memory;
a digital de-multiplexer connected to an output of said central control unit for selecting one of a plurality of de-multiplexer outputs to which a de-multiplexer input coupled to said central control unit is to be connected;
a plurality of control latches, each connected at one output of said digital de-multiplexer, for storing the digital data received from it and actuating a part of the appliance to adjust the sensed parameter;
a non-volatile memory storing the data and control parameters required for the operation of said central control unit and said linearity, sensitivity and offset correction circuit; and
an input of said central control unit is further connected to a device selected from the group consisting of;
a real-time clock providing time-of-day data, a remote control interface unit receiving user input and providing responses to the user from/to a remote control device, and a network interface unit providing bidirectional transfer of data between the digital control unit and other devices external to said digital electronic control unit. - View Dependent Claims (22, 23, 24, 25, 26, 27, 28, 29, 30, 31, 32, 33, 34, 35, 36, 37, 38, 39, 40, 41, 42, 43, 44)
-
Specification